Major Duties and Responsibilities
The appointee will be responsible mainly for the following:
- Leading the supporting staff in the provision of administrative services in the Undergraduate Enrolment Team of the Registry;
- Handling course enrolment of undergraduate & sub-degree programmes;
- Executing and overseeing enrolment-related activities, such as the formulation of enrolment schedules and coordination of enrolment logistics;
- Handling all academic probation matters, such as monitoring at-risk students, management of academic probation logistics, and records keeping;
- Liaising with Schools and units on enrolment-related functions such as student progressions, study plans, and study duration;
- Handling course-level system set-up and website update related to enrolment functions;
- Contributing to the review and implementation of policies, regulations, and procedures related to undergraduate enrolment, and its related system enhancement;
- Providing administration support for student record matters, such as registration of students, subsidy applications, other general administrative duties and enquiry services;
- Assisting supervisor(s) in preparation and maintenance of course-related data/files, reports, and committee work;
- Performing any other duties as assigned by the Registrar or his/her nominee(s).
Candidates
Candidates should possess the following qualifications, experience and competence:
- A recognized degree or equivalent, with at least 2 years' relevant post-qualification administrative and supervisory experience;
- Excellent communication and writing skills in both English and Chinese, preferably including Putonghua;
- Proficiency in Microsoft Office applications, hands on experience in Oracle System and WordPress will be an advantage;
- Excellent interpersonal skills and able to work closely and engage with various stakeholders;
- Ability to work under pressure and multi-task;
- Strong analytical, organizational and problem-solving skills;
- Self-motivated with a strong sense of responsibility, pro-active, attentive to details, and able to work independently under tight timeline; and
- Outstanding leadership skills and team spirit.
